Q: Is 136,787,902 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 136,787,902 is a composite number.

Why is 136,787,902 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 136,787,902 can be evenly divided by 1 2 43 86 953 1,669 1,906 3,338 40,979 71,767 81,958 143,534 1,590,557 3,181,114 68,393,951 and 136,787,902, with no remainder.

Since 136,787,902 cannot be divided by just 1 and 136,787,902, it is a composite number.
